Calculating the linearisation curve

(using previous tank example)

In the menu window "

Linearisation -- user

programmable curve --" you can start the
vessel calculation program. With the vessel
calculation program you can calculate (using
dimensions from the technical drawings of
the vessel) the correlation of filling height to
filling volume. If the curve is defined this way,
gauging by incremental filling is not neces-
sary - your sensor will output volume as a
function of level.

• Click to

"Calculate".

The tank calculation program starts. In the
top left corner you choose the vessel type
(upright tank, cylindrical tank, spherical tank,
individual tank form or matrix). When choos-
ing matrix, you can enter a user-programma-
ble linearisation curve by means of index
markers. This corresponds to the input of
value pairs (linearisation points), as previ-
ously described.

In the following example, the tank calculation
program calculates the linearisation curve of
a vessel corresponding to the vessel in the
previous gauging example.

• Click to "

individual tank form" and choose

three round tank segments with the dimen-
sions 0.88 m • 0.9 m (height by diameter),
0.66 m • 0.47 m and 0.66 m • 1.12 m (this
tank form corresponds to the tank form of
the gauging example).
